Game Recap

In the initial game of their AL Division Series rematch, the Blue Jays earned a commanding 10-1 win over the Rangers. This victory was fueled by Marco Estrada's strong pitching, as he maintained a shutout deep into the ninth inning, and a late three-run home run from Jose Bautista helped punctuate the decisive outcome.
